AI Model Router for Coding Teams

Build a vendor-neutral routing layer that automatically selects the best model and reasoning level for coding tasks based on cost, quality, and latency targets. The strongest demand comes from teams already spending on premium AI plans but lacking confidence in model selection.

Why this matters

You are paying for AI coding help, but every request feels like a gamble. The smaller model is sometimes marketed as the practical choice, yet in harder workflows it can end up costing almost as much as the premium option while producing weaker output. You also do not fully trust built-in auto modes, because they may optimize for provider margin rather than your delivery goals. So your team ends up creating informal rules, manually switching models, and debating whether to plan with one model and implement with another. The result is wasted spend, inconsistent quality, and constant second-guessing during everyday development work.

MVP Scope · 1–2 weeks

Week 1
  • Build a small API gateway that forwards prompts to two or three model providers
  • Create a rules engine for routing by task type, token budget, and latency target
  • Add logging for request cost, latency, and user-selected outcome rating
  • Design a simple dashboard showing model choice and savings per request
  • Recruit 5 developer teams for pilot access with sample coding workflows
Week 2
  • Ship a VS Code extension that lets users route prompts through the gateway
  • Implement default policies such as fast, balanced, and best-quality modes
  • Add fallback behavior when a preferred model is unavailable or too slow
  • Generate weekly reports comparing actual costs versus manual model selection
  • Run pilot tests and tune routing thresholds based on observed task outcomes

Why This Might Fail

Self-rebuttal — the most important trust signal

  1. 1If model vendors rapidly improve their own routing and bundle it into core products, an external router may feel redundant.
  2. 2If routing quality is inconsistent across coding tasks, users may revert to manually selecting a favorite model.
  3. 3If API margins are thin and support burden rises with each new provider, the business may struggle to scale profitably.
